''The Cleaner'' is a [[Creator/{{BBC}} [=BBC=] One]] BlackComedy which first aired in 2021. A ForeignRemake of the German comedy ''Series/DerTatortreiniger'', it stars Creator/GregDavies as a Crime Scene Cleaner named Paul 'Wicky' Wickstead. Wicky "Wicky" Wickstead, a professional crime scene cleaner who works for the Shropshire-based cleaning service Lausen on cleaning Lausen. Each episode is about what happens when he goes to clean up crime scenes. As a place where someone has died. While trying to clean up, he does, he usually encounters people related to the said victim, from victim -- their relatives and employers, to their neighbours and sometimes even their murderers.
